
Sunday’s Café 64 is a ministry café offering menu items from breakfast sandwiches, waffles, and french toast to shrimp & grits, gumbo, and grilled honey-baked cornbread. Oh, and don’t forget First Fridays at Sunday’s for Deep-Fried Whiting and freshly made sides of collards, mac & cheese, cheese grits, sausage gravy or yams. Our customers have voted our biscuits #1 in the area. Our signature Sweet Tea Slushy is a real crowd pleaser too! We also offer homemade treats such as peach cobbler, bread pudding and pineapple upside-down cake just to name a few. DISCLAMER – SC64 is not a fast-food eatery. It is a very cozy place. Beautiful ambiance. We weren’t aware that we needed to make a reservation to be able to sit and eat. The gentleman that was working was able to get us a table. I noticed that there was a large table reserved for a party of 6 that did not seem to show up. Anyway, the atmosphere was nice. We ordered our food, Chicken biscuit sandwich and chicken and waffle. We had to wait about 40 min for our food but we expected that since everything was cooked to order. When we got our food it had nice portions. My husband got the chicken & biscuit which was a nice size. Large portion. My food wasn’t ready yet so I ate some of his. The chicken was tasty. When I received my plate I was surprised to see that I had a large waffle with chicken wings on top. I was expecting chicken fingers. I was later told that they had run out of chicken fingers. I wish I knew before they substituted with wings. I had been eating wings all week and was looking forward to the fingers. Anyway I began eating and found that the wings were under cooked and the waffle was wet and doughy in the middle. I think maybe the batter was too thick. I was very disappointed and ended up throwing the waffle away and took the wings home to cook a little longer. I was very disappointed in the food and I don’t know if I will go back anytime soon. I do hope that if and when I go back that I can give a better review. I would really like to support this establishment. I still recommend you check it out. Maybe I was just there on an off day.
